195 Deputy Joanna Tuffy asked the Minister for Health and Children if her attention has been drawn to the fact that, at present, the school age disability speech and language therapy service in Dublin West is not operational; when this service will commence in view of the need to address this situation due to the number of children who urgently require these services;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[34666/10]
